首页 » Web前端 » JSP分页查询技术与应用

JSP分页查询技术与应用

duote123 2025-02-18 0

扫一扫用手机浏览

文章目录 [+]

数据量呈现爆炸式增长,如何高效地处理海量数据,满足用户的需求,成为各大企业关注的焦点。分页查询作为一种常用的数据检索技术,在提高用户体验、降低服务器压力等方面发挥着重要作用。本文将深入探讨JSP分页查询技术,分析其原理、实现方法及在实际应用中的优势。

一、JSP分页查询原理

JSP分页查询技术与应用

1. 数据库分页查询

数据库分页查询是分页查询的基础,通过SQL语句实现对数据库中数据的分页处理。常见的分页查询方式有LIMIT、OFFSET等。

2. JSP分页查询

JSP分页查询是在数据库分页查询的基础上,结合JSP页面技术,实现用户在浏览器端查看分页数据的功能。其原理如下:

(1)获取当前页码:通过请求参数获取当前页码,如page=1表示第一页。

(2)计算每页显示数据量:根据实际需求设置每页显示的数据量,如每页显示10条数据。

(3)计算起始位置:根据当前页码和每页显示数据量,计算出数据库查询的起始位置,如第一页的起始位置为0。

(4)执行数据库分页查询:使用计算出的起始位置和每页显示数据量,执行数据库分页查询,获取当前页数据。

(5)生成分页导航:根据总页数和当前页码,生成分页导航,方便用户切换页面。

二、JSP分页查询实现方法

1. 使用JDBC进行分页查询

(1)创建数据库连接:使用JDBC连接数据库。

(2)编写SQL语句:使用LIMIT和OFFSET实现分页查询。

(3)执行查询:使用PreparedStatement执行SQL语句,获取查询结果。

(4)生成分页导航:根据总页数和当前页码,生成分页导航。

2. 使用分页插件

(1)引入分页插件:在项目中引入分页插件,如PageHelper。

(2)配置分页插件:在配置文件中配置分页插件的相关参数。

(3)使用分页插件:在查询方法中使用分页插件进行分页查询。

三、JSP分页查询应用优势

1. 提高用户体验

分页查询可以减少一次性加载大量数据,降低用户浏览压力,提高用户体验。

2. 降低服务器压力

分页查询可以减少数据库查询次数,降低服务器压力,提高系统稳定性。

3. 提高数据检索效率

分页查询可以快速定位用户所需数据,提高数据检索效率。

JSP分页查询技术在处理海量数据、提高用户体验、降低服务器压力等方面具有显著优势。在实际应用中,可以根据需求选择合适的分页查询方法,以提高系统性能。本文从原理、实现方法及应用优势等方面对JSP分页查询技术进行了深入探讨,希望对读者有所帮助。

参考文献:

[1] 张三,李四. JSP分页查询技术研究[J]. 计算机技术与发展,2018,28(2):123-128.

[2] 王五,赵六. 基于分页查询的JSP页面设计[J]. 计算机与现代化,2017,27(4):78-82.

[3] 刘七,陈八. JSP分页查询技术在企业应用中的实践与优化[J]. 计算机技术与发展,2019,29(1):45-49.

标签:

相关文章

房山第一探寻历史文化名区的魅力与发展

房山区,位于北京市西南部,历史悠久,文化底蕴深厚。作为北京市的一个重要组成部分,房山区的发展始终与首都的发展紧密相连。房山区积极推...

Web前端 2025-02-18 阅读1 评论0

手机话费开钻代码数字时代的便捷生活

我们的生活越来越离不开手机。手机话费作为手机使用过程中的重要组成部分,其充值方式也在不断创新。手机话费开钻代码应运而生,为用户提供...

Web前端 2025-02-18 阅读1 评论0

探寻专业奥秘如何查询自己专业的代码

计算机科学已成为当今社会不可或缺的一部分。掌握一门专业代码对于个人发展具有重要意义。面对繁杂的学科体系,如何查询自己专业的代码成为...

Web前端 2025-02-18 阅读1 评论0